Fundamentals of Commuter Bike Fit Philosophy: Why Comfort Trumps Performance
Ergonomics for bicycle commuting differs fundamentally from athletic setups. While road cyclists prefer a stretched, aerodynamic position, commuters need a more upright posture for better all-around visibility and relaxed neck positioning. The time factor also plays a decisive role: instead of 2-3 hours of peak performance, it's about 1-3 hours of daily comfort.
The four pillars of commuter ergonomics form the foundation for your optimal bike setup. First, long-term comfort takes center stage: your position must remain pain-free for several hours. Second, the setup must be compatible with various types of luggage – from light laptop bags to heavy groceries. Third, road traffic requires an upright position for optimal safety and visibility. Fourth, the bicycle adjustment for professionals must work with various clothing styles.
Biomechanical studies show that office workers often have shortened hip flexors and weak core muscles due to their sedentary work. These physical characteristics require adapted bike settings: less aggressive sitting positions, higher handlebars, and wider saddles. Classic road bike proportions are often counterproductive for office life.
Another important aspect is regular adjustment. While sport cyclists rarely change their setup, commuters should check their settings every 3-6 months. Seasonal clothing changes, weight fluctuations, and changing fitness levels require continuous fine-tuning for optimal comfort.
Setting Saddle Height for Commuters Correctly: The Key to Pain-Free Riding
Saddle height for commuters follows different rules than in competitive sports. Instead of the classic 25-30 degree knee bend at the lowest pedal position, ergonomic experts recommend 20-25 degrees for commuters. This slightly reduced seat height relieves the knees during longer rides and enables safe dismounting in city traffic.
The proven heel-on-pedal method provides a good starting point: Place your heel on the pedal in the lowest position – your leg should be almost straight. For commuters, you add about 109% to your inseam (instead of the athletic 110-115%) to get the optimal saddle height. This formula accounts for the more relaxed riding style and the need to ride comfortably even with thick shoes.
Documenting different saddle heights for various shoe types is particularly important. Note the optimal settings for sneakers, business shoes, and winter boots. A difference of 1-2 cm between different shoes is normal and should be compensated by corresponding saddle height adjustments.

Modern smartphone apps like "Bike Fast Fit" can help with measurement, but don't replace your own feel. After each adjustment, ride at least 10-15 minutes and watch for pressure points or tension. You'll find the perfect saddle height through gradual 5mm adjustments over several weeks.
Optimizing Handlebar Reach and Height: Relaxed Neck, Strong Back
Setting handlebar reach correctly is particularly critical for commuters, as it directly influences neck and shoulder comfort. Commuter-optimized setups generally use stems 2-5 cm shorter than in road racing. This shortened reach enables a more upright torso position and significantly reduces stress on the cervical spine.
For maximum comfort, handlebar height should be about at saddle height or slightly above. This is achieved through appropriate spacer combinations or switching to a more steeply angled stem. Many commuters benefit from adjustable stems that allow fine-tuning as needed.
Arm position provides important clues about optimal setup: your elbows should be slightly bent in a relaxed riding position – not straight or heavily bent. Wrists remain in neutral position – a common mistake is hyperextension due to handlebars set too low.

When selecting stems, you should also consider the angle. A 17-degree stem additionally raises the handlebars and can replace spacers. For extreme uprightness, there are special "riser stems" with 35-45 degree angles that are particularly helpful for back problems.
Saddle Selection and Ergonomic Components: Comfort for Professional Life
The choice of the right saddle differs significantly for commuters from the sports sector. While road cyclists prefer narrow, hard saddles, professionals need wider models that are comfortable even with thicker clothing. To your measured sit bone width, you add 20-30mm as a commuter instead of the athletic 10-15mm.
Saddle shape plays a decisive role: flat saddles are suitable for athletic positions, curved models better support upright postures. Many commuters benefit from saddles with central relief channels that reduce pressure peaks and promote circulation. Gel inserts can provide additional comfort, especially during the break-in period.
For pedal selection, comfort and safety are paramount. Platform pedals with non-slip surfaces enable riding with various shoes and facilitate quick dismounting in traffic. Those who still prefer clipless pedals should choose systems with wide contact surfaces and low release resistance.

Ergonomic grips are often overlooked but crucial for wrist health. Models with palm support reduce pressure on the ulnar nerve and prevent hands from "falling asleep." Bar ends or horns provide additional grip positions for long rides and reduce one-sided stress.
Adapting to Luggage and Use Cases: Flexibility for Everyday Life
Bicycle ergonomics must adapt to various luggage scenarios. A heavy laptop backpack shifts your center of gravity backward and requires a slightly forward-shifted sitting position. Front luggage like handlebar bags influences steering geometry and may require stem angle adjustments.
Seasonal adjustments are particularly important: winter clothing is thicker and may require a 5-10mm higher saddle position. Thicker gloves change grip diameter, which can be compensated by appropriate grip selection. Document these seasonal settings for quick changes.
Weight distribution with different luggage options significantly influences your optimal riding position. While panniers (side bags) barely affect balance, high backpacks require a more upright position for stability. A bike computer or smartphone mount should be positioned so it's readable without neck strain.
With multi-purpose bicycles, compromises are unavoidable. Adjustment systems like height-adjustable stems or seatposts with quick-release enable rapid adaptations between different usage scenarios. This flexibility is particularly valuable when the bike is used both for commuting and weekend tours.
How Do I Set Up My Commuter Bike Correctly? - Frequently Asked Questions
How often should I check my bike setup?
As a commuter, you should perform a basic check every 3-6 months. After major weight changes, injuries, or persistent discomfort, immediate review is appropriate. Even during bicycle maintenance work, settings can shift.
What role does my fitness play in bike fit setup?
Your physical condition significantly influences optimal position. Less trained riders need more upright positions and shorter reaches. With improved fitness, settings can gradually become more athletic. Similar to sports nutrition, individual adaptation is crucial.
Can I make my bike fit adjustments myself or do I need professional help?
Basic settings like saddle height and position can be done yourself with the right instructions. For more complex adjustments or persistent problems, professional help is recommended. Many bicycle repairs require expertise anyway.
What do I do if I have pain despite correct setup?
Persistent discomfort may indicate health problems beyond bike fitting. Consult a doctor or physiotherapist. Sometimes higher-quality components like ergonomic saddles or grips are also necessary.
How does my workplace affect optimal bike setup?
Office workers with tense shoulders and shortened hip flexors often need more upright positions. Physically active professions allow more athletic settings. Ergonomic optimization should consider both aspects – workplace and bicycle.
What role does weather play in bike fit setup?
Winter clothing requires higher saddles and possibly wider handlebars. Rain gear restricts mobility and may necessitate a more upright position. Plan these adjustments into your seasonal maintenance routine.
